In sintesi

Conditions will change quickly as precipitation and wind increase this afternoon. Step back from steep, wind-drifted slopes as you start to see signs of instability like shooting cracks and collapsing in the snowpack. Give yourself a wide margin for uncertainty as buried weak layers get loaded by new snow.

A natural avalanche cycle could occur overnight and into tomorrow morning if the weather forecast verifies.

  • Wind Slabs

    • Alta quota
    • Limite del bosco
    • Sotto il limite del bosco
    Probabilità
    Likely
    Dimensione
    1–2

    New snow and strong southwest winds will build another layer of fresh wind slabs. Expect drifts to grow in size and sensitivity throughout the day. Watch for snow blowing across ridgelines and gullies and loading leeward slopes. Wind slabs can look rounded and textured, or sound hollow under your feet. Shooting cracks and collapsing in drifted snow are clear warning signs to dial back your terrain choices and stick to wind-sheltered terrain.

  • Persistent Slabs

    • Alta quota
    • Limite del bosco
    • Sotto il limite del bosco
    Probabilità
    Possible
    Dimensione
    1.5–2.5

    Large to very large natural and remotely triggered avalanches failed on buried weak layers in the past 24 hours. Recent field observations from up and down the forecast area have noted poor structure and signs of instability, such as shooting cracks and audible collapsing in the snowpack. Managing persistent slabs is difficult. They may be triggered remotely—from flatter terrain adjacent to steep slopes. Persistent slabs often propagate widely and in unpredictable ways. Shooting cracks and collapses are clear warning signs of the problem. However, feedback is often irregular. The best option is to minimize your exposure to steep terrain on the aspects and elevations with sugary facets buried under stiffer slabs. We expect loading from new snow and wind to exacerbate the problem this afternoon and overnight.

Avalanche Discussion

A winter storm is expected to intensify throughout the day, with increasing winds and snowfall, which will raise the avalanche hazard. Dangerous conditions may develop before nightfall in areas that receive snow early. The storm is set to strengthen overnight, potentially triggering a large natural avalanche cycle into early tomorrow morning.

New precipitation will fall and drift onto dense snow from Tuesday’s storm. Surfaces this morning include graupel (which resembles styrofoam balls) and wind-packed snow on northerly slopes. There are slick crusts on south and west aspects hit by the sun or stripped by the wind. Layers of large sugary facets and facet-crust combos are buried a foot or more deep in areas north and south of Mammoth. They can be found more than 3 feet deep where winds have drifted the most snow onto shady aspects under cliff bands near the Sierra Crest, and on leeward slopes near treeline above about 9,000 feet. Feedback from these persistent weak layers can be inconsistent and a dangerous source of uncertainty. One thing is for sure: new loading will not make the problem go away.

Given the uncertainty of both the incoming storm and the snowpack, the best strategy is to make careful terrain choices, maintain a wide safety margin, and be prepared to retreat from steep slopes as conditions deteriorate.
